Purpose of the role:
ESG Senior Internal Control Specialist is responsible for designing, implementing, and maintaining a comprehensive ESG internal control framework that contributes to ensuring integrity, accuracy, and reliability of reported ESG metrics.
This role is responsible for assessing developments in the ESG risk landscape and translating these into risks and controls. Acting as the designated representative of the global internal control function within the ESG Task Force, this role will provide expertise integrating ESG metrics into overall internal control framework and partner with relevant workforce stream in advising the business to streamline and harmonize processes applied for collection, consolidation and reporting of ESG metrics.
Your responsibilities:
Design and maintain an effective and efficient internal control framework tailored to cover risks associated with collection, consolidation and reporting of ESG metrics.
Develop and maintain an ICS ESG roadmap outlining the short-, medium-, and long-term actions required to establish a robust internal control environment over processes to collect and consolidate ESG metrics; define clear milestones, deliverables, and timelines for implementing ESG internal controls.
Collaborate with cross-functional teams (e.g., Global Sustainability, Finance, Procurement, HR, IT) to align the ESG Internal Control Roadmap with the overall ESG roadmap and reporting objectives/prioritization.
Mon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of implemented ESG controls and recommend improvements.
Promote awareness of ESG controls across the organization through training and guidance for process owners, control owners, data providers and other key stakeholders
Serve as the primary point of contact for external auditors and assurance providers on matters related to internal controls over ESG data and reporting (including co-ordinate preparation and delivery of documentation, process flowcharts, control evidence)
Serve as the formal representative of the global internal control function within the ESG Task Force.
Provide subject matter expertise on internal control requirements and collaborate with relevant workstream teams to ensure internal controls are integrated in business processes applied for collection, consolidation and reporting of ESG metrics.
Advise on improving processes for ESG data collection, consolidation, and reporting; identify gaps and propose solutions to streamline and standardize processes for collecting and reporting of ESG data, leveraging technology where possible and applicable.
Establish and maintain a structured process to continuously monitor global ESG regulatory developments, reporting standards, and emerging best practices relevant to internal controls and ESG disclosures.
Collaborate with Governance & Frameworks lead to support in driving awareness of control responsibilities and support ongoing training efforts.
Participate and support in the evaluation, selection, and implementation of ESG reporting tools and provide internal control requirements to ensure proper controls are embedded in system configuration.
Engage with other companies and in industry forums and webinars (offered by consulting companies) to stay informed about leading ESG practices and control approaches.
Our requirements:
Minimum 4-5 years in Internal or External Audit or Risk Management (experience in related strategy & governance roles in other companies is desired).
Deep understanding of internal control frameworks and ability to develop and implement effective ESG controls.
Strong understanding of ESG frameworks and reporting requirements, such as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ive (CSRD), IFRS Sustainability Disclosure Standards and EU Taxonomy.
Experience in conducting ESG reporting risk assessments is highly desirable.
Experience in developing plans and roadmaps, including prioritization and stakeholder alignment.
Experience in contributing to process enhancement and automation initiatives, e.g., data collection, consolidation and reporting processes.
Proficiency with relevant tools (e.g., SharePoint, GRC platforms, Microsoft Suite)
Technical knowledge and familiarity with tools (e.g., Workiva, Schneider Electrics, OneTrust, SAP Sustainability Tower) used in ESG area is highly desirable
Effective communication and presentation skills, capable of engaging and aligning stakeholders across levels and functions.
Ability to work constructively across different Group functions and hierarchies.
Project management, ability to plan, prioritize, and manage multiple internal control initiatives simultaneously.\
Fluent English language skills
Other languages e.g. German, French, Spanish, Portuguese, Italian, Mandarin, are an advantage.
Ability to engage and influence a wide range of stakeholders.
